Hermione had aspirations of going to Oxford.

It was her dream university, and she wanted nothing more than to study there. She had it all planned out at the age of six, when her first grade teacher asked her what she wanted to do when she grew up. Dedicating herself to her assignments as always, she planned her entire life out – every nook and cranny, every step was there for her to take as time passed by.

She always looked straightforward, knowing exactly what she was going to do, planning and assuring herself on how she was going to get there.

Destiny had many things in store for Hermione Granger. Her original plans, however, weren't one of them.

She had plans A, B, C – all the way to Z. If one path didn't work, she would manage to modify it to another one, but she did plan to reach the same destination. She wasn't counting on ever having to use her plan B, but she always wanted to be prepared. Hermione Granger was always prepared.

She had been one hundred percent certain that she was heading to Oxford University; there was no doubt in her mind. She was sure she would become as successful as her parents or make a name for herself in the scientific community.

This was what she was striving for, this was her reality: exceed at everything and be the best.

This was one in two times where her whole life plan, everything she once knew, changed.

Her world altered when she received her acceptance letter to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ry. After her first experience with magic, she wondered how she could have remained dormant for so long. She wondered how she could not have been exposed, able to experience such a beauty in the world as magic.

Her old world was gone, and she stepped into this new world with open arms and a wand, ready to excel at Hogwarts as well. Because Hermione Granger, no matter what it was, would be the best at whatever she did.

And this change was simple, because it was magic, and it excited her and it was fascinating.

She knew she belonged, and her entire world had morphed into new dreams and aspirations.

This was the very first instant where she had to rethink everything she once knew.
